FERRIC CHLORIDE

Broad-spectrum inorganic coagulant for use in drinking water, waste water and industrial water.

Identified uses:

  • Manufacture of formulations.
  • Treatment of raw water: drinking water and industrial process water.
  • Treatment of waste water and sewage sludge (sludge dewatering).
  • Treatment of biogas.
  • Use as reagent or precursor in the manufacture of other chemicals.
  • Surface treatment – etching.
  • Laboratory and agrochemical use.
  • Use in sealing adhesives and coatings.
